Title
libexif整数溢出漏洞
Description
libexif是一个使用C语言编写的函数库,用于从图形文件中读写EXIF元信息。 libexif中存在整数溢出漏洞。攻击者可利用该漏洞造成拒绝服务和信息泄露(包括:重要堆块的元数据或其他应用程序的敏感数据)。
